如何设置服务器定时启动程序 (服务器设置定时启动程序)

在服务器运行期间,我们经常需要定时启动某些特定的程序,以完成一些自动化的任务或者特定的功能。但是,大多数管理员都需要手动登录到服务器并手动启动这些程序,这种方式既浪费时间又不够高效。本文将介绍,以便让管理员能够轻松地管理和自动化服务器上的任务。

1. 使用任务计划程序

Windows服务器默认自带任务计划程序,该程序可以帮助管理员轻松设置定时任务。以下是如何使用任务计划程序设置定时启动程序的步骤:

步骤一:打开“任务计划程序”,在左侧面板中选择“任务计划程序库”。

步骤二:选择“创建任务”,在弹出窗口中填写任务详细信息,包括任务名称、描述等内容。

步骤三:在“触发器”选项卡中,选择适当的触发条件,例如每天、每周、每月等。

步骤四:在“操作”选项卡中,选择要执行的程序、命令行参数等。

步骤五:在“条件”选项卡中,可以设置任务执行的条件,例如只有当电脑在空闲状态时才执行任务。

步骤六:在“设置”选项卡中,设置如何运行任务,例如是否允许在用户未登录时运行等。

2. 使用Cron

Linux服务器使用的是Cron,该程序与Windows的任务计划程序类似,也可以轻松设置定时任务。以下是如何使用Cron设置定时启动程序的步骤:

步骤一:打开终端或SSH客户端。

步骤二:输入“crontab -e”命令以打开Cron的编辑器。

步骤三:在编辑器中输入要执行的命令,例如“0 0 * * * /usr/bin/python /home/user/program.py”表示每天00:00自动执行“/home/user/program.py”。

步骤四:设置完成后保存并退出。

需要注意的是,Cron是在后台运行的,因此即使管理员退出登录,定时任务仍然会按时执行。

3. 使用第三方工具

除了Windows自带的任务计划程序和Linux自带的Cron之外,还有一些第三方工具可以帮助管理员轻松设置定时启动程序。其中一些工具还可以为管理员提供更多的设置选项和功能。以下是几种比较流行的第三方工具:

a. Jenkins:Jenkins是一款流行的开源自动化服务器,可以轻松设置定时任务并跟踪任务的执行情况。

b. Cygwin:Cygwin是一个为Windows提供类Unix环境的工具箱,其中包含了bash、grep、sed以及Cron等常用工具。

c. TaskSchedulerView:TaskSchedulerView是一款简单实用的任务调度程序,可以帮助管理员轻松设置任务并监控任务的执行情况。

在服务器运行期间,定时启动程序可以极大地提高管理员的工作效率,并且可以使一些重复、繁琐的任务自动化,解放管理员的双手。本文介绍了使用Windows自带的任务计划程序、Linux自带的Cron以及第三方工具来设置定时启动程序的方法,希望对读者有所帮助。

相关问题拓展阅读:

如何让IIS定时自动重新启动

让IIS定时自动重新启动

如果要重启机器,可以如余枯直接添加个毁模计划任务,选择shutdown.exe;shutdown -r -f -t 0 只是重启IIS服务,可以使用iisreset /restart 把命令做成批处理文件,然后渣洞做个计划任务来运行这个批处理。

定时重启含饥服务器,伴随日志被清除,有一下几个原因:1、启动项被加拍老余载相关程序。2、系统服务项被加载相关程序,自己手动查找可疑服务项。3、就是你说的计划性任务。4、黑客后门程序调用相关程序。以前曾经是肉鸡,那肯定有后门,不知道你找到了没?不要过分依赖杀毒等软件,黑客种木马可以避开这些的。一定不要掉以轻心,查找可疑端口,找出黑客进入的方法,才能袭滚有效解决问题。

服务器设置定时启动程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于服务器设置定时启动程序,如何设置服务器定时启动程序,如何让IIS定时自动重新启动的信息别忘了在本站进行查找喔。


数据运维技术 » 如何设置服务器定时启动程序 (服务器设置定时启动程序)